1. Brekeke Product Name and Version: SIP Server 3.3.8.1
2. Java version: 8
3. OS type and the version: Server 2008 R2
4. UA (phone), gateway or other hardware/software involved:
Rauland R5 to Cisco CM
5. Your problem:
A call is established from Brekeke to Cisco CM. During the call, Cisco redirects the call to a dispatcher's extension. Cisco then sends an Invite mid-call to Brekeke. There is no response from Brekeke so the call is terminated from Cisco. Can Brekeke send a mid call 200 OK response? |

R5 does not support re-INVITE.
It is the reason.
Let you disable re-INVITE at Cisco. |

I understand that R5 does not support the re-INVITE. That is hwy I was wondering if Brekeke can intercept that re-INVITE and send an acknowledgment on behalf of the R5 device. Is that possible?
Also, Cisco cannot disable the re-INVITE for some reason. |

Let you add the following line in the Deploy Patterns .
Code: |
$session = rfc3264handler block |
It blocks re-INVITE and respond by SIP server. |
